How do I find my email host?

Find your domain host
  1. Go to lookup.icann.org.
  2. In the search field, enter your domain name and click Lookup.
  3. In the results page, scroll down to Registrar Information. The registrar is usually your domain host.

Is Gmail a mail server?

Use the Gmail SMTP server

If you connect using SSL or TLS, you can send mail to anyone inside or outside of your organization using smtp.gmail.com as your server.

What is the host mail server for Gmail?

smtp.gmail.com
